Nottingham Forest are close to their first signing of the summer. Football Insider claim that Emiliano Marcondes is now in talks with the Reds over a move.
The 26-year-old helped the Bees into the Premier League last season. His goal in the Play-Off Final put the seal on a famous win.
It wasn’t enough to earn him an extension though. Marcondes was one of three first-team players not offered a new contract.

He played 40 times during 2020/21, starting eight games in Thomas Frank’s team. The versatile midfielder scored three goals and claimed three assists.
Now, with a move to Forest looking to be on the cards, supporters have been reacting to the news on Twitter.
Marcondes can play as a conventional midfielder or as a No.10. He stands at 6ft tall and played in both games against Forest during 2020/21
He looks like the type of player that would allow Forest to tweak their system in-game. His passing is incisive and he can prove a real nuisance around the penalty area.
